Chapter 6 - Electronic Structure of Atoms - Additional Exercises - Page 253: 6.87a

Answer

Blue is absorbed most strongly when a plant is orange.

Work Step by Step

As said in the question, the observed color is the complementary color, which is the color across in the color wheel shown. So, if a plant is orange, the color that is absorbed most strongly is the one across orange in the color wheel, which is blue.
